repeat.... This one is a pretty good extreme METAL band from Liverpool, England. CARCASS. Genre: Grindcore (early circa); Melodic/Brutal Death Metal (later years).

Just in case for those who don't know, Carcass is considered to be the MAJOR inspiration and musical foundation for most deathgrind/goregrind/brutal Death Metal bands, as well as being one of the founding *fathers of MELODIC death metal *when they had switched their genre to the melodic death metal sound by the early '90s.

Band Name: LIMBONIC ART. One of the finest and highly talented founders of the Symphonic Black Metal underground scene in Norway.

Country: NORWAY (more specifically Sandefjord, and Vestfold og Telemark ). Formed in 1993 .

Genre: Symphonic BLACK METAL, Epic/Extreme Black Metal (melodic). Unlike other Norwegian BM bands, their music does not focus on the "Raw" Black metal genre, or "True Norwegian" Black Metal genre. Instead they have their own unique musical notes, and style.

Lyrical Themes on which the band mainly focus are as follows: Theory of the Cosmos, Universe, Nihilism and Void, Solitude, Death, and Darkness/Dark spirits.

Btw, Ezo moved to the U.S. in an attempt to gain success overseas. They were discovered by Gene Simmons of KISS band fame who produced their self-titled American debut in 1987.

Ezo were the second Japanese metal band behind Loudness to chart on the Billboard 200 and did so reaching #150. During this time they also toured America in support of hard rock band Guns N' Roses/Axl Rose. After the release of Fire Fire album in 1989, "Geffen Records" dropped them and the band broke up shortly after. Vocalist Masaki Yamada went on to play in Loudness and Hirotsugu Homma also joined Loudness and later joined Anthem.

Actually, when it comes to Loudness band, they even hired Michael Vescera as the vocalist for their album Soldier of Fortune !
